dc.description.abstract | It is important for older and disabled people who live alone to be able to cope with the
daily challenges of living at home. In order to support independent living, the Smart Home Care
(SHC) concept offers the possibility of providing comfortable control of operational and technical
functions using a mobile robot for operating and assisting activities to support independent living
for elderly and disabled people. This article presents a unique proposal for the implementation of
interoperability between a mobile robot and KNX technology in a home environment within SHC
automation to determine the presence of people and occupancy of occupied spaces in SHC using
measured operational and technical variables (to determine the quality of the indoor environment),
such as temperature, relative humidity, light intensity, and CO2 concentration, and to locate occupancy
in SHC spaces using magnetic contacts monitoring the opening/closing of windows and doors by
indirectly monitoring occupancy without the use of cameras. In this article, a novel method using
nonlinear autoregressive Neural Networks (NN) with exogenous inputs and nonlinear autoregressive
is used to predict the CO2 concentration waveform to transmit the information from KNX technology
to mobile robots for monitoring and determining the occupancy of people in SHC with better than
98% accuracy. | cs |
